Elvis Presley, often hailed as the King of Rock and Roll, has left an indelible mark on the music industry and popular culture. However, behind the glitz and glamour lies a lesser-known story that has fascinated fans for decades: the existence of his twin brother. Born just 35 minutes apart, Elvis and his twin brother, Jesse Garon Presley, shared a bond that would shape Elvis's life in countless ways. The story of Elvis Presley’s twin is one that intertwines tragedy, loss, and the complexities of fame, making it a captivating subject for those interested in the life of the legendary artist.

Jesse Garon Presley was stillborn, leaving Elvis to grow up as the sole surviving child in a family grappling with the weight of this profound loss. This tragedy not only impacted the Presley family but also influenced Elvis's music and persona throughout his career. The shadow of his twin brother loomed large in Elvis's life, leading many to speculate how things might have been different had Jesse lived. The emotional ramifications of this experience undoubtedly shaped Elvis into the man and performer he became.

What Was the Early Life of Elvis Presley Like?

Born on January 8, 1935, in Tupelo, Mississippi, Elvis Aaron Presley grew up in a modest household. His family faced financial struggles, which were exacerbated by the Great Depression. Despite these challenges, Elvis's mother, Gladys, nurtured his love for music from an early age. This passion would soon evolve into an extraordinary career, but the circumstances surrounding his birth would forever haunt him.
